Viet Nam - Import of Lumber of Coniferous (Softwood) Wood
Since 2014, Viet Nam Import of Lumber of Coniferous (Softwood) Wood jumped by 3.5% year on year. At $177,313,974.2 in 2019, the country was number 25 among other countries in Import of Lumber of Coniferous (Softwood) Wood. Viet Nam is overtaken by Canada, which was number 24 with $185,518,592 and is followed by Lithuania with $161,923,427.74. China ranked the highest with $5,217,985,941.09 in 2019, that is an increase of 4.5% compared to 2018. United States, Japan and United Kingdom resp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Pakistan witnessed the best average annual growth at +251.9% per year, while Panama recorded the worst performance at -79.1% per year.
